You may pay by:
- Due to local regulations, cash payments in US dollars for consular services must be made with banknotes that are not stained, stamped, written on, damp, wrinkled, torn, dirty (dirt / dust), or discolored. Series CB and D banknotes will not be accepted. Please bring exact change if possible. For your safety and convenience we recommend credit card payments. Credit card payments require the cardholder to be physically present. We also accept payment in Guaranies.
Please note that we cannot accept personal checks or debit cards.
U.S. citizens that are eligible to renew their U.S. passport using the DS-82 form must renew their U.S. passport by mail and pay the fee online at https://www.pay.gov/public/form/start/607957567
